The old WS_RETRY_TOKEN setting has been renamed to BRAMBLECAST_RECONNECT_SECRET to fix a websocket reconnect bug: clients resuming a session after a dropped connection were validated against the legacy name, which the gateway stopped reading in 3.8, so reconnects silently downgraded to unauthenticated polling. For the security review: the value itself is unchanged, only the key name; rotation is recommended but not required. Deployments must update their env file to include the renamed entry as follows.

vault entry, yahif-yajep: COURIER_KEY29=b802bdf8034096b65a51c6ba5abe2

Ticket: Vault locked — cutoff rule config unreachable

The Ovenline config vault is locked; nobody can edit the bakery order-cutoff rule (currently 14:00, should move to 16:00 for the Harrowgate pilot). Orders after cutoff silently drop — two complaints so far. Need unlock before Friday's batch run. Raising at weekly sync for owner. Unlocking requires the recovery passphrase recorded below.

unlock words, hahip-baduf: holwyn-istath-julvan

**Ticket CI-1187: Build agents disagree about what time it is**

Hey on-call — Dovetail agents 4 and 7 are drifting ~3s apart and artifact signing keeps failing.

Repro:
1. Queue any build on the Hollowpine pool.
2. Watch it land on agent 7.
3. Signing step rejects the timestamp as "from the future."

To poke the agent admin endpoint yourself, use the token below.

login token, bagug-kafop: eyJhbGciOiJIUzI1NiIsInR5cCI6IkpXVCJ9.eyJzdWIiOiIcMLov2In0.Z5RLDIfp